Homestead Lodge & Dining at Ski Brule
Homestead Lodge & Dining at Ski Brule is a unique institution located at 397 Brule Mountain Road in Iron River, Michigan. This cozy lodge, situated mid-mountain, offers delicious food and family fun in a historic setting. The lodge itself is the 1800's Oberg Homestead, with vintage photographs and antiques adorning the walls. The original Homestead Act, signed by President McKinley, hangs proudly on display. Guests can gather around the antique pot belly stoves, the only source of heat in the lodge, to swap stories after a day on the slopes. The Homestead Lodge is open Thursday through Sunday, with limited hours during certain times of the season. Visitors can enjoy lunch on the sunny deck while watching the slopes, or warm up inside with a Supreme Hot Chocolate and giant cookie. A highlight of the experience is the Homestead BBQ, Tubing & Sleigh ride on Saturday nights, offering an all-you-can-eat barbecue dinner and fun activities for the whole family.

Lake Antoine Camp Grounds
Lake Antoine Camp Grounds is a picturesque campground located on Lake Antoine Road in Iron Mountain, Michigan. This beautiful park offers a variety of lodging options, from tent sites to RV hookups, making it the perfect destination for a weekend getaway or a longer vacation. Surrounded by nature, visitors can enjoy activities such as hiking, fishing, and swimming in the crystal clear waters of Lake Antoine. With its serene atmosphere and stunning views, Lake Antoine Camp Grounds is the ideal place to relax and unwind in the great outdoors.
